“Michael Conforto undergoes season-ending shoulder surgery” PHOENIX — Michael Conforto’s free agency will spill over into next offseason. The former Mets outfielder underwent surgery on his right shoulder last week that will keep him sidelined for all of 2022, according to agent Scott Boras.
